The quote could be seen on page number 186.
This is one of the famous quote from a book called 'I am Malala'
The book told a story about a girl that grew up in the Taliban and have to experience many form of silencing and thought policing.
The quote indicated that people often forget how good it is to live in a place where you could express your opinion freely.

<h2> Further Explanation </h2>

Malala Yousafzai and her struggle for education for women in Pakistan began to become an international spotlight when she was shot in the head by the Taliban and survived. My Malala is a story of growing up in Pakistan that is slowly turning into an unrecognizable state under a non-secular extremist government.

When the Taliban moved to Pakistan they began to severely limit women's rights, preferring they were not seen or heard and forbade girls from visiting schools.
